Animals, wind, water, and explosions contribute to the process of erosion and sediment transport. Erosion occurs when these forces break down rocks and soil, moving particles from one location to another. For instance, water can carve out riverbeds, wind can shape dunes, and explosions can displace materials. Together, they reshape landscapes and influence geological formations over time.

Seeds can be dispersed in a number of different ways. They may be carried by wind, water or even by animals.
The process of seeds being carried to a new location is called seed dispersal. This can occur through various mechanisms, including wind, water, animals, or gravity, allowing plants to spread and colonize new areas. Effective seed dispersal is crucial for the growth and survival of plant species.
The metabolic process that produces carbon dioxide and water in plants and animals is called cellular respiration. During this process, glucose is broken down in the presence of oxygen to generate energy, releasing carbon dioxide and water as byproducts. This process occurs in the mitochondria of cells and is essential for energy production in both plants and animals.

Three mechanisms for seed dispersal are wind dispersal (seeds carried by wind currents), animal dispersal (seeds carried by animals), and water dispersal (seeds carried by water currents). Adaptations for seed dispersal include structures like wings or hairs on seeds that aid in wind dispersal, fruit that attracts animals to eat and disperse seeds, and buoyant seed coats that enable water dispersal.
Calcium is carried in water through the process of dissolution, where water interacts with minerals and elements to dissolve them into a solution. This allows calcium to be transported and distributed in water bodies.
